Jennifer Simmons is an Assistant Professor of Physician Assistant Studies and Clinical Coordinator at Franklin College. She joined the institution to focus on teaching, guiding, and mentoring future healthcare providers. Her expertise emphasizes evidence-based medicine, blending clinical practice with educational innovation.
Her research interests center on advancing clinical education methodologies, fostering humility and empathy in healthcare providers, and promoting lifelong learning. She actively integrates real-world patient care experiences into her teaching to prepare students for competent, compassionate practice.
In her role, she prioritizes student development through hands-on mentorship, ensuring they embrace both the art and science of medicine. While no specific grants or awards are noted, her contributions to curriculum design and student success are highlighted in her professional narrative.
